如何为AI对话系统设计高效的错误处理机制
在人工智能技术飞速发展的今天,AI对话系统已成为我们日常生活中不可或缺的一部分。从智能客服到聊天机器人,AI对话系统为用户提供了便捷、高效的服务。然而,在享受这些便利的同时,我们也发现AI对话系统在处理错误时往往显得力不从心。如何为AI对话系统设计高效的错误处理机制,成为了当前研究的热点问题。本文将通过讲述一个AI对话系统工程师的故事,探讨这一问题。
故事的主人公名叫李明,是一名年轻的AI对话系统工程师。他毕业于我国一所知名大学,在校期间就表现出对人工智能的浓厚兴趣。毕业后,李明加入了一家知名互联网公司,从事AI对话系统的研发工作。
刚入职时,李明满怀激情地投入到工作中。然而,在实际开发过程中,他发现AI对话系统在处理错误时存在诸多问题。例如,当用户输入错误的指令时,系统往往无法正确识别,导致对话中断;当系统遇到未知问题无法解答时,也无法给出合理的解释。这些问题严重影响了用户体验,让李明倍感压力。
为了解决这些问题,李明开始深入研究AI对话系统的错误处理机制。他发现,现有的错误处理方法主要分为以下几种:
忽略错误:当系统遇到错误时,直接忽略,不进行任何处理。这种方法简单易行,但会导致用户体验不佳,甚至产生安全隐患。
报错并终止对话:当系统遇到错误时,立即报错并终止对话。这种方法能够保证对话的顺利进行,但无法为用户提供任何帮助,反而增加了用户的困扰。
人工干预:当系统遇到错误时,自动将问题提交给人工客服,由人工客服进行处理。这种方法能够确保问题得到解决,但成本较高,且效率低下。
在深入研究这些方法后,李明发现它们都有各自的优缺点。为了设计出高效的错误处理机制,他决定从以下几个方面入手:
提高错误识别能力:李明首先对AI对话系统的错误识别能力进行了优化。他通过分析大量用户数据,找出常见的错误类型,并针对性地改进算法,使系统能够更准确地识别错误。
智能推荐解决方案:针对不同的错误类型,李明设计了相应的解决方案。例如,当用户输入错误的指令时,系统会自动推荐正确的指令;当系统遇到未知问题时,会给出可能的解决方案供用户参考。
优化错误处理流程:为了提高错误处理效率,李明对错误处理流程进行了优化。他将错误处理过程分为以下几个步骤:识别错误、推荐解决方案、用户确认、反馈结果。通过优化流程,使错误处理更加高效。
经过一段时间的努力,李明设计的AI对话系统在错误处理方面取得了显著成效。以下是他取得的一些成果:
错误识别准确率提高了20%;
错误处理速度提高了30%;
用户满意度提升了15%。
李明的故事告诉我们,为AI对话系统设计高效的错误处理机制并非易事,但只要我们用心去研究,就一定能够找到解决问题的方法。以下是李明总结的一些经验:
深入了解用户需求:在设计和优化错误处理机制时,要充分考虑用户的需求,确保系统能够为用户提供更好的服务。
不断优化算法:随着技术的不断发展,要不断优化算法,提高错误识别和处理能力。
加强团队协作:在设计和优化错误处理机制的过程中,要加强团队协作,共同解决问题。
关注用户体验:在设计和优化错误处理机制时,要关注用户体验,确保系统能够为用户提供便捷、高效的服务。
总之,为AI对话系统设计高效的错误处理机制是一项具有挑战性的工作,但只要我们不断努力,就一定能够取得成功。李明的故事为我们提供了宝贵的经验和启示,让我们在未来的工作中,为用户提供更加优质的AI对话服务。
猜你喜欢:智能问答助手